Some exploration implies that while damaging thoughts for instance guilt can prompt eco-friendly actions, guilt must be deployed with care. one example is, right after the United Kingdom instituted a coverage of charging a little sum for disposable plastic grocery luggage, mass communications researcher Sidharth Muralidharan, PhD, of Southern Methodist College, carried out a web-based survey that identified that Girls who documented significant guilt over forgetting to carry reusable luggage ended up far more likely to carry them more continually, but Gentlemen with large levels of guilt weren’t, suggesting Gals had been extra liable to “environmentally friendly guilt” than Guys.
